The Boy with the Bamboo Flute

PATCH THEATRE COMPANY (AUST)

A flute and a sword... a butterfly and an ogre.. a story about the meaning of strength. Inspired by the folk-lore and cultural traditions of Vietnam, The Boy with the Bamboo Flute is a story of an unlikely friendship between a princess and a peasant boy, who must journey into the forest, with only a bamboo flute to defend themselves. Written by Vietnamese Australian artists Ta Duy Binh and Dang Thao Nguyen, mime, dance, martial arts and traditional Vietnamese music combine in a performance that seeks to develop awareness of Vietnamese culture for school audiences.
